About The Position

Restaurant Associates is seeking a dynamic and collaborative Director of Retail to lead a high-profile hospitality portfolio at the World Bank. This role oversees a diverse retail dining operation serving approximately 3,500 to 4,000 associates daily across 5 cafés and 5 coffee bars. The Director will provide strategic and operational leadership for a team of approximately 150 union hourly associates, supported by six direct-report managers, while ensuring exceptional guest experiences, operational excellence, and a strong client partnership. The operation runs on a highly desirable Monday through Friday schedule with holidays off, offering a strong work-life balance within a prestigious corporate dining environment.
